pub enum MediaProfile {
Standard,
BrowserAudio,
}Expand description
A named composition of call/media requirements.
Standard preserves the independently selectable SIP media policies. BrowserAudio is the
fail-closed one-stream profile in docs/specs/webrtc-audio.md; selecting it never authorizes
fallback to the standard policy.
Variants§
Standard
Ordinary SIP audio with independently selected codec, ICE, and keying policies.
BrowserAudio
Opus-first audio over WSS, ICE, DTLS-SRTP, and multiplexed RTCP.
